Output 0aa43f823353ae4f66a16fcb0b12705556e04efb8c25c6a5c83e2b4976948527:0

value
12489278
script pubkey
OP_0 OP_PUSHBYTES_20 ceaaf9e2a6ac52884478f72597657de06d8301b8
address
bc1qe640nc4x43fgs3rc7ujewetaupkcxqdcsyudh8
transaction
0aa43f823353ae4f66a16fcb0b12705556e04efb8c25c6a5c83e2b4976948527